Sun rises on renewable energy and storage

One long-held excuse for not getting off oil, gas and coal faster is that energy sources like solar and wind only work when the sun's shining or the wind's blowing. Now, rapid advances in energy storage technologies, along with falling prices, have rendered that excuse meaningless.

Share this story

Related stories

Help Grow Progressive Daily News